Question 65696: sqrt2y+7 + 4 = y
The sqrt is 2y+7
I am not sure how to work this problem since the equal number is a letter. How would I go about figuring out this equation?

sqrt2y+7 + 4 = y
sqrt%282y%2B7%29%2B4=y
sqrt%282y%2B7%29%2B4-4=y-4
sqrt%282y%2B7%29=y-4
%28sqrt%282y%2B7%29%29%5E2=%28y-4%29%5E2
2y%2B7=y%5E2-8y%2B16
2y-2y%2B7-7=y%5E2-8y-2y%2B16-7
0=y%5E2-10y%2B9
0=(y-1)(y-9)
y-1=0 or y-9=0
y-1+1=0+1 or y-9+9=0+9
y=1 or y=9
Check for extraneous solutions:
for y=1
sqrt%282%281%29%2B7%29%2B4=1
sqrt%289%29%2B4=1
3%2B4=1
7=1 False, therefore y=1 is extraneous
For y=9
sqrt%282%289%29%2B7%29%2B4=9
sqrt%2818%2B7%29%2B4=9
sqrt%2825%29%2B4=9
5%2B4=9
9=9 True, y=9 is valid.
The only true solution is highlight%28y=9%29
